Maoist Center instructs all 1,700 general convention delegates to undergo PCR test



KATHMANDU: The CPN-Maoist Center has instructed all 1,700 delegates attending the recently held general convention to undergo a PCR test.

Maoist Center’s central office Chief Secretary Shri Ram Dhakal said all the delegates have been strictly instructed to undergo PCR test and adopt caution as the COVID19 infection was confirmed in many staffers and leaders, including the party chair, after the general convention.

The party asked all delegates to undergo a PCR test through province committees.

Dhakal said half a dozen leaders, including Chair Pushpa Kamal Dahal ‘Prachanda’ and leader Narayan Kaji Shrestha, and a dozen other party office staffers have contracted the coronavirus.

The party also halted all non-essential works at the Parisdanda-based central office from Thursday. Prachanda’s personal secretary Ramesh Malla has also been diagnosed with the virus infection.

COVID19 infection has been detected in many leaders following the Maoist Center’s 8th general convention that concluded last Sunday.

The general convention ran for 8 days with over 1,700 delegates participating in the gathering.
